3

我仅在 Google Chrome 浏览器上遇到 JavaScript 性能问题。问题是网站有一段时间运行流畅,但在浏览页面几秒钟后,页面只是冻结了 2 或 3 秒。我认为一个问题可能与 synchronaus ar 循环方法调用有关。但接下来的问题是,为什么 Mozilla Firefox 或 Microsoft Intenet Explorer 不冻结?

实际上,我什至不知道到底要问什么,但我想如果你们中的某个人能告诉我解决问题的可能方法,我将能够知道答案。为了让事情更清楚,我将向您展示我得到的 Google Chrome Timeline: Google Chrome Timeline http://img840.imageshack.us/img840/5998/timelinen.png 正如您所看到的,它表明在一段时间内处理器会解析 JavaScript顺利,但几秒钟后,JavaScript 解析就冻结了。

那么,您有什么想法会导致此类问题吗?任何帮助,将不胜感激。如果您需要更多信息,请随时询问。如果我了解自己,我会尽量告诉你需要的一切。

4

1 回答 1

2

当我使用非常大的精灵时,我有类似的东西。我认为谷歌浏览器在图像处理方面存在性能问题。Mozilla firefox 和opera 工作更流畅。

如果您有大精灵(大于 2000x2000),请尝试拆分为更小的部分。

于 2012-06-03T15:29:29.653 回答